About Trivet

Trivet opened on Snowsfields in Bermondsey in 2019, founded by former Fat Duck head chef Jonny Lake and former Fat Duck head sommelier Isa Bal. It won its first Michelin star in 2021 and a second in 2023, making it one of the few two-star restaurants south of the river.

The cooking is rigorously technical — the Fat Duck lineage shows in fermentation work, precise temperatures, and dishes that reward close attention — but the presentation is calmer than the Heston heritage might suggest. Ingredients lean Mediterranean with frequent Turkish, Catalan, and Alpine references.

The wine list is Bal's statement — exceptionally deep in Sherry, Madeira, and aged European whites, with service-end-friendly glass pricing that rewards exploration. The dining room is small (around 45 seats), well-lit, and one of the quieter Michelin-tier rooms in London.

Best Occasion Fit

Trivet is the south-of-the-river choice for deal dinners with clients based in the City or the South Bank. The Fat Duck pedigree registers with anyone who knows British fine dining, the wine programme gives the evening a structure beyond the food, and the room volume supports the kind of conversation deals actually require.
